The Benefits of Cold Showers That You Didn’t Know

0
61

Cold showers have long been thought of strictly in terms of waking one’s body up and having a refreshing start to the day, but they may offer a number of other potential benefits as well. From mental to physical health, cold showers may offer a number of benefits that you didn’t know about – and many of them don’t even take long to experience.

Mental Health

One of the more surprising benefits is the positive effect it has on mental health. Studies have shown that cold showers can reduce stress and depression levels, allowing people to have a better overall mood. The cold water helps to stimulate the brain to produce “happy hormones”, such as norepinephrine, serotonin and endorphins, which help to reduce feelings of anxiety, depression and other mental health disorders.

Improved Circulation

Cold showers can also help to improve circulation. The cold water helps to constrict the blood vessels and capillaries near the skin, which can help to increase blood flow to deeper areas of the body. This can be beneficial for those who suffer from poor circulation or arthritis, as the increased blood flow provides relief and reduces pain.

Weight Loss

Cold showers can also help with weight loss. The body uses energy to heat up cold water to body temperature, causing the body to burn more calories than it would in a warm shower. Additionally, the cold water helps to stimulate the metabolism, increasing the number of calories burned throughout the day.

Immune System

Cold showers can help to improve the overall functioning of the immune system. The cold water causes a tightening of the skin which helps to prevent bacteria from entering the body. It can also stimulate the lymph nodes, which helps to flush out toxins from the body and increase immune response.

Muscle Health

Cold showers are also beneficial for muscle health. The cold water helps to reduce inflammation and soreness in the muscles. It also helps to improve blood flow to the muscles, allowing for more efficient recovery after a workout.

Improved Sleep

Finally, cold showers can help to improve sleep. The cold water helps to reduce body temperature and make the body more relaxed, which can lead to better sleep quality. Additionally, the cold water helps to reduce stress levels, which can make it easier to fall asleep and stay asleep.
